Databricks has an employee rating of 4.0 out of 5 stars, based on 1,623 company reviews on Glassdoor which indicates that most employees have a good working experience there. The Databricks employee rating is in line with the average (within 1 standard deviation) for employers within the Tecnologías de la información industry (3.9 stars).

Thank you for your feedback. We're sorry that you feel this way. One of our recruiting philosophies is to do our due diligence with anyone we hire. We evaluate each candidate thoroughly. Each candidate meets 4 or more Brick-sters and we require references from every candidate we extend an offer to. Being the start-up that we are, we understand our process is not bullet proof and we can get better. Unfortunately, we're going to have some misses as we develop and grow as a company. We will learn from our mistakes and do our best to not duplicate them.

Pros

Visionary CEO and Founding team with a strong product roadmap

Cons

Ruthless Hire and Fire policy implemented by a few teams in India expecially GDC Professional Services team. Firing is fully discriminated and leadership is favorable and Biased towards a few people. Lot of Regional Bias and horrible culture. You never know who they fire and that too with a couple of week's notice and in some cases a day's notice. CEO insists on strong technical leadership, but a few leaders in India lack basic knowledge on Databricks. They are mastered in Firing ruthlessly. CEO gives high impact technical presentations, while middle management mumble infront of customers or they shield themselves using RSAs. Structured, performance based and unbiased lay off's based on performance are totally fine. Ruthless firing and being favorable to a specific set of people based on region is unbearable. I am writing with bottom of my heart that mid-senior leadership is safe guarding folks from their region and firing potential talent.
